 B-IV 535 at City Hall, June 21, 2003 |  Destination sign. There are 4 rows each with 3 columns. The top 3 rows display destinations (both are displayed at once, as in New York City. The bottom row displays LOCAL, EXPRESS, and SPECIAL. On Spur trains, this row is blank. The front of the train has the first three rows but the information from the bottom row is in the form of marker lights (more details below). |  B-IV 330 at Fern Rock, June 27, 2001 |  B-IV 330 at Erie, June 23, 2001 |  B-IV 669 at Pattison, June 21, 2003 |  B-IV 510 at Pattison, June 21, 2003 |  B-I at Fern Rock, June 27, 2001 |

Marker Lights
Red=Used on rear of train only Green=Express White=Local Yellow=Spur Blue=Special
